Highlights
Revenue:

Axos Financial Inc.’s revenue jumped 22.15% since last year same period to $564.23Mn in the Q1 2026. On a quarterly growth basis, Axos Financial Inc. has generated 0.23% jump in its revenue since last 3-months.

Net Profits:

Axos Financial Inc.’s net profit jumped 18.51% since last year same period to $124.68Mn in the Q1 2026. On a quarterly growth basis, Axos Financial Inc. has generated -2.9% fall in its net profits since last 3-months.

Net Profit Margins:

Axos Financial Inc.’s net profit margin fell -2.98% since last year same period to 22.1% in the Q1 2026. On a quarterly growth basis, Axos Financial Inc. has generated -3.12% fall in its net profit margins since last 3-months.

PE Ratio:

Axos Financial Inc.’s price-to-earnings ratio after this Q1 2026 earnings stands at 10.59.

Return on Assets (ROA):

Return on assets (ROA) indicates the profitability of the company in relation to its total assets. This ratio tells the financial health of the company. The higher the ROA, the better the company’s financial health. If any company has a ROA in the range of 5% to 20% - it is generally considered good. ROA above 20% is generally considered excellent. Axos Financial Inc.’s return on assets (ROA) stands at 0.02.
